嗨,好奇心十足的小朋友!当你的朋友或家人赢得了一场比赛时,制作一个简单的庆祝动画是一个超级酷的主意!下面,我将带你一步步了解如何制作这样一个小动画,既简单又充满乐趣。
准备工作
首先,你需要以下工具:
- 动画制作软件:如Adobe Animate、Pencil2D或FlipaClip等。
- 音乐编辑软件(可选):如Audacity,用于添加背景音乐。
- 一些基本的素材:比如胜利的手势、奖杯、气球等。
步骤一:构思动画内容
在开始制作之前,先想一下你想要展示的庆祝场景。比如,你可以设计一些角色在欢呼、奖杯升起或者有烟花绽放的画面。
步骤二:创建动画场景
设计角色和物体:在软件中绘制角色和物体,例如,一个人物庆祝胜利的姿势,一个奖杯或者一束烟花。
添加动画:
- 帧动画:通过逐帧改变角色或物体的位置、形状等,来制作简单的动画效果。
- 补间动画:使用软件提供的工具,可以自动生成中间帧,让动画看起来更流畅。
步骤三:添加动作和效果
动作:为角色添加一些基本的动作,比如跳跃、挥舞手臂等。
特效:如果使用的是像Adobe Animate这样的专业软件,你可以添加一些特效,如光芒、粒子效果等,让动画更加生动。
步骤四:添加背景音乐和音效
- 选择音乐:选择一首欢快的背景音乐,让整个动画更加有气氛。
- 添加音效:比如庆祝的欢呼声、奖杯落地的声音等,可以让动画更加逼真。
步骤五:导出和分享
导出动画:完成动画制作后,导出为视频格式,比如MP4或GIF。
分享动画:将你制作的动画分享给朋友或家人,让他们也感受到这份喜悦!
示例代码(如果使用编程软件)
如果你使用的是像Processing这样的编程软件,下面是一个简单的示例代码,用来创建一个简单的庆祝动画:
void setup() {
size(400, 400);
}
void draw() {
background(255);
// 绘制庆祝的烟花
fill(255, 0, 0);
ellipse(mouseX, mouseY, 50, 50);
fill(255, 255, 0);
ellipse(mouseX, mouseY - 20, 50, 50);
fill(0, 0, 255);
ellipse(mouseX, mouseY - 40, 50, 50);
// 更新烟花位置
mouseY -= 5;
if (mouseY < 0) {
mouseY = height;
}
}
通过这样的步骤,你就可以制作出一个简单又有趣的庆祝动画了。祝你制作愉快,也祝你的朋友或家人在比赛中取得好成绩!
